## Escalation — ProctorLine Exam Queue

ProctorLine queues candidate sessions for live exam proctoring at Veridane Assessments. If queue depth exceeds 200 or median wait passes 10 minutes, first confirm the session-router pods are healthy and that the scheduler feed is current. Contractors may restart the router once; do not drain the queue or cancel sessions — that requires a staff engineer. If the restart does not clear the backlog within 15 minutes, escalate to the proctoring operations desk below.

billing contact of kagaf-bahif = fraox_ralvan_tamwyn@zemvarcloud.local

- [ ] Step 7: Archive cold storage buckets (Glacierline tier). Confirm both ceremony witnesses are present, verify bucket manifests match the Oxbow ledger, then seal the archive key shares. Plugin authors may observe but not handle shares. Once sealed, the archive index itself is encrypted and can only be reopened with the passphrase below.

vault phrase of badup-hahig = tamael-aldael-kelmir-istael-fenok-istwyn-tamius-jorath-oliion

## Runbook: Tumblevault Locker Access

When a resident scans their fob, the gateway requests a one-time unlock grant from the Tumblevault access service. Grants expire after 90 seconds and are never reissued; failures should be retried from the kiosk, not replayed server-side. If the access service restarts, verify the grant-signing secret is loaded before reopening lockers. It is set by the following line in `/etc/tumblevault/env`:

env line for yahag-kajog: VAULT_KEY13=e1c568d90102d